″$1M AI x-risk grant round is live on grantmaking.ai - apply for funding, review applicants, or fund projects” by mbrooks, Mckiev
TLDR: what is the grant round? grantmaking.ai is launching a 1 million dollars grant round, distributing 5 thousand dollars to 50 thousand dollars per successful application to people and projects working to reduce x-risk from AI. Applications will be reviewed by Gavin Leech, Ryan Kidd, and Marcus Abramovitch. We aim to make all funding decisions by July 28th. Applications submitted by July 13th are guaranteed a priority review. You can still apply after July 13th, and we will make our best effort to review late submissions as long as funding remains. Grant applications will be mostly public, though we allow certain sensitive details to be kept private. Even if you are not applying, we invite you to join the platform to review and comment. We have set aside 100 thousand dollars of the budget to be given to top commenters as regranting budgets, so please share your thoughts and help us pick out awesome projects! Who are we? grantmaking.ai was initialized by Anton Makiievskyi, who is funding this round and brought the team together, built by Matt Brooks (lead dev) and Melissa Samworth (ui/ux), and advised by Austin Chen with Manifund handling grant distribution.
